.NET Core 3.1预览版简介
2 。 .NET Core 3.1将是一个小版本,着重于对Blazor和Windows桌面(.NET Core 3.0的两个重要新版本)的关键增强。 这将是一个长期支持(LTS)版本,预计最终推出日期为2019年12月。
您可以
下载适用于Windows,macOS和Linux的
.NET Core 3.1 Preview 2 。
ASP.NET Core和EF Core现在也可用。
现在还提供了Visual Studio 16.4 Preview 3和Visual Studio for Mac 8.4 Preview 3。 这些是使用.NET Core 3.1预览版2所必需的更新。VisualStudio 16.4包括.NET Core 3.1,因此,简单的Visual Studio更新将为您安装两个版本。
详细资料:

增强功能
此版本中最大的改进是对C ++ / CLI(又称为“托管C ++”)的支持。 C ++ / CLI仅在Windows上可用。 C ++ / CLI的更改主要在Visual Studio中进行。 要使用C ++ / CLI,您需要设置“ C ++桌面开发”工作负载和“ C ++ / CLI支持”组件。 您可以在下图中看到该选定组件(最后显示)。

该组件添加了两种可以使用的模式:
- CLR类库(.NET Core)
- CLR空项目(.NET Core)
如果找不到它们,只需在“新建项目”对话框中找到它们。
结论
.NET Core 3.1的主要目标是改进我们在.NET Core 3.0中引入的功能和脚本。 .NET Core 3.1将是一个
长期支持(LTS)版本 ,至少支持3年。
请安装并测试.NET Core 3.1 Preview 2并留下您的评论。 请注意,不建议将该版本用于生产。
如果您突然错过了它,请阅读
.NET Core 3.0的公告。
另请参阅:
7个针对开发人员的免费课程